KingKapalone posted:Ok so all should work fine if I reformat the PC, install the controller, launch it (sounds like I might lose Wi-Fi here if the APs get confused?), and then restore the config? Then Wi-Fi would come back up. Trying to minimize that downtime since my wife will be working. Unless you're doing something like running a captive guest portal which depends on the controller (sounds like you're not) the APs will continue to merrily do what the controller last told them to do until you fire up the controller again and make a configuration change. What you do have to be aware of with UniFi Network backups is that they're version-specific so when you migrate PCs make sure to grab the version of the UniFi Network application that matches your backup and everything will go swimmingly.

At a certain point it turns into a test of your ISP or the website's ISP, instead of your home network. That's the point at which you use iperf instead if what you actually want to test is your home network.

for one, the speedtest.net site has a large variety of different providers endpoints scattered in multiple facilities through many different paths and you don't really know which is the closest to your ISP at any given time The netflix one is usually pretty good because it's built-in with their deep edge caches that they stick real close to end user ISP's, but... They all are just basically a single pizza box or an app on a cluster that has its own local limitations, and if it's full it's full, it might be on a 10 gig link, but you might not get your full share among other users it's all best effort

Should my 2.4 GHz and 5 GHz wifi networks have the exact same SSID, or should I use something like Fart_24 & Fart_5? Some of my devices are 2.4-only, but there is no logical/operational distinction in use. This is for my tiny condo. Right now I have different SSIDs for the different bands, but if I add a guest SSID then suddenly I have 4 networks in the menu, which seems excessive. (yeah, I know that doesn't really matter)
|
# ? Apr 13, 2024 03:52 |
|
You definitely don't need to do that for guests. Whether something connects to 2.4 or 5 is up to the client, with some APs able to influence via band steering. I used to be pro separate, but now I'm fairly neutral on it. With the exception that some IoT devices will only do 2.4 and also not be smart enough to use a blended 2.4/5 network. If you don't have any of those, I wouldn't bother splitting. If you do, I'd leave your combined network and make a specific 2.4 network for those devices only.
|
# ? Apr 13, 2024 03:56 |
|
Some pieces of equipment allow you to blend 2.4/5 into a single SSID, but also turn off 2.4 or 5Ghz if needed. Useful for those lovely little IoT devices that only do 2.4 and sometimes don’t want to pair with your blended network. Shut off 5Ghz band, pair the device, turn 5Ghz back on.
